Cause: in-memory sort swapped to an unstable quicksort in the last refactor. Fix: revert to the stable merge sort and add a tiebreaker on record creation sequence. Added regression tests covering duplicate keys across grouped and ungrouped reports. Verified output matches the archived golden reports byte-for-byte. Risk: low; performance delta under 2% on the largest fixture. Merge is blocked pending sign-off from the responsible engineer, named below.

account owner for bawip-tahag: Raleth Quenok

Discussed the flaky resolution errors hitting the Quillbank API cluster since Tuesday. Failures are intermittent, roughly 2% of lookups, and correlate with one upstream resolver pool. Mitigation in place: lowered TTLs and added a fallback resolver, which cut error rates overnight. Root cause still unconfirmed; packet captures are scheduled for tomorrow. On-call should not restart services for this — it doesn't help and resets the capture window. Escalations for this issue go to the engineer named below.

signatory, kafop-bahaf: Lamion Queniel Jorir Olidor

Management Meeting Minutes — Heads of Department

Attendees: full leadership group, Quillon Apps.

Main topic: the new "Lumen Plus" subscription tier. Pricing lands between basic and pro; pilot starts in the Ashgrove market. Support flagged staffing needs; engineering confirmed billing changes ship next sprint. Marketing wants a soft launch, no press. Churn targets to be set next session. The strategic reasoning behind the tier is captured in the note below.

board note of yajeg-yaweg: The pricing group signed off on a budget of $4.9 million for Project Quenix. The renewal with Sormirek Freight closes at $6.1 million a year, 37 percent below the last contract.

Ticket: Missed pick-up — Thornbury Regional Chess Final score sheets

The scheduled collection of the signed score sheets from the Aldermere Pavilion did not occur on the arranged afternoon. The arbiter, Mr. Fenwick, retains the sealed envelope on site. Please arrange a replacement collection and ensure the courier hand-over follows the confidential instruction noted below.

dispatch memo: the lamwyn fenwyn courier leaves the wenir ledger at gate 7175 under passcode 822969